BUSTAMANTE VALDES, Matías  and  DIAZ LEVICOY, Danilo. Analysis of evaluative activities on statistical graphs in the teacher's textbook for chilean rural education. Conrado [online]. 2020, vol.16, n.77, pp.436-441.  Epub Dec 02, 2020. ISSN 2519-7320.

This investigation aims to analyze the evaluative activities on statistical graphs in the textbook proposed by the Chilean Ministry of Education for Rural Multigrade Primary Education. For the analysis, we consider 52 evaluative activities proposed for the courses from the 1st to the 6th grades, through a qualitative type methodology of descriptive level and using the content analysis method, having as units of analysis the type of graph, skill required and variable type. The results show the predominance of the simple bar graph, the skill required to interpret and the type of nominal qualitative variable. In the evaluative activities, we observe statistical graphs that are not explicit in the curriculum guidelines, such as the simple bar graph for the 1st grade and the dispersion graph for the 6th grade. Besides, we suggest activities where the students must make changes in register (from graph to table or to another graph) and others that allow them to construct graph.
